What is the cheapest Tel Aviv to North America flight route?

The cheapest ticket to North America from Tel Aviv found in the last 5 days was to New York, at ₪2,654 round-trip. The most popular route is from Tel Aviv (TLV) to New York John F Kennedy Intl Airport (JFK), and the cheapest round-trip airline ticket found on this route in the last 5 days was ₪2,654.

What is the cheapest time of day to fly to North America?

The cheapest time of day to fly to North America is generally in the morning, when round-trip flights cost ₪3,703 on average. Morning departures are around 16% cheaper than evening flights, on average. The most expensive time of day to fly to North America is generally in the evening, which is peak travel time and where the average cost of a ticket is ₪4,385.

Can I save money by flying with a layover from Tel Aviv to North America?

No, with an average price for the route of ₪4,071, prices are generally cheapest when you fly direct.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Tel Aviv to North America?

The cheapest month for flights from Tel Aviv to North America is February, when tickets cost ₪2,839 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are August and July,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is ₪4,238 and ₪4,114 respectively.

What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Tel Aviv to North America?

When flying from Tel Aviv to North America, you should consider leaving on a Tuesday and avoid Sundays if you are looking for the best rates. For your return to Tel Aviv, you’ll find the best rates on Sundays and the most expensive ones on Saturdays.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Tel Aviv to North America?

To get a below average price on the flight from Tel Aviv to North America, you should book around 2 weeks before departure, which saves you about 14%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 5 weeks before departure.

OlgaFlew with EL AL-May 2026
There is only one airport. The security at the airport is the same for all flights. Be aware that Israeli security does not include checking for liquids. So they do that at the gate for flights flying to the USA. Also be aware that you need to go through security *before* checking in at the counters.
YossiFlew with EL AL-Jan 2024
No drinking bottles above 100ml when boarding, even if it is from the duty free.

The entertainment included very many Israeli movies and tv shows. The El Al app did not update to tell me the gate. The most important thing you should know is that El Al is very security conscious. Prepare to go through a security check at the gate. They look through the passport and boarding pass, through your carry on bags, ask questions, etc. Then they give you a sticker and only then can you board. So get to the gate about half an hour before you would otherwise.
